Just How Cold Laser Therapy Functions
To understand just how cold laser therapy works, you need to understand the basic principles of just how light power communicates with organic tissues. Cold laser therapy, additionally known as low-level laser therapy (LLLT), makes use of specific wavelengths of light to pass through the skin and target hidden cells. Unlike the intense lasers used in operations, cold lasers produce reduced levels of light that don't create warmth or trigger damages to the tissues.
When these gentle light waves get to the cells, they're absorbed by parts called chromophores, such as cytochrome c oxidase in mitochondria. This absorption sets off a collection of biological responses, including boosted cellular power production and the release of nitric oxide, which improves blood circulation and minimizes inflammation.
Moreover, the light power can additionally boost the production of adenosine triphosphate (ATP), the power currency of cells, aiding in cellular fixing and regrowth procedures.
In essence, cold laser treatment utilizes the power of light power to advertise healing and ease discomfort in a non-invasive and mild manner.
Devices of Activity
Just how does cold laser therapy in fact work to produce its healing impacts on organic cells?
Cold laser therapy, additionally known as low-level laser treatment (LLLT), operates with a procedure known as photobiomodulation. When the cold laser is applied to the skin, the light energy passes through the cells and is absorbed by chromophores within the cells.
These chromophores, such as cytochrome c oxidase in the mitochondria, are after that promoted by the light power, causing a cascade of biological reactions. One crucial device of action is the improvement of mobile metabolism.
The absorbed light power raises ATP manufacturing in the mitochondria, which is crucial for cellular feature and fixing. In addition, cold laser therapy assists to reduce inflammation by inhibiting inflammatory moderators and promoting the launch of anti-inflammatory cytokines.
This anti-inflammatory impact contributes to discomfort relief and cells recovery.
